By New Mexico State Land Office Public Schools are the Sole Beneficiary of Revenues Earned SANTA FE, NM – State Land Commissioner Aubrey Dunn today announced Avangrid Renewables’ El Cabo Wind Project, located four miles west of Encino in Torrance County, has commenced commercial operations. The 87,000-acre project spans 27,000 …

WASHINGTON – Today, U.S. Senator Tom Udall delivered a statement urging members of Congress in both parties to be prepared to defend Special Counsel Robert Mueller’s investigation into Russia’s interference in the 2016 election and President Trump’s campaign. Udall, a member of the Senate Appropriations Committee, authored an amendment in …
